Set in BUNKER, Missouri, BUNKER HIGH is a minimally staffed four-year high school, overseen by BUNKER R-III. It teaches 123 students across grades 6 through 12. By comparison, Missouri's public schools average about 501 students each, so BUNKER HIGH sits 75% leaner than that benchmark.
BUNKER HIGH is one of 2 schools operated by BUNKER R-III, a district that teaches 228 students overall.
Demographically, BUNKER HIGH records that the student body is overwhelmingly White (96%). Beyond that, the school records 2% Asian.
On the resource side, Staff filings list 12 full-time-equivalent teachers, which works out to roughly 10.2:1 students per teacher. That figure is tighter than the state norm's 12.2:1 average. An estimated 54% of students are eligible for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ment.
After controlling for student poverty, BUNKER HIGH sits in the middle band of the BeatsExpectations distribution. Schools with this campus's student mix typically land near 50.3%; this one delivers 61.9%.
Across the wider county, Reynolds County reports that median household income runs about $45,028, 15%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and the poverty rate sits near 16%. In all, Reynolds County runs 8 public schools (combined enrollment of about 854 students), of which BUNKER HIGH is one.
Nearest neighbor: BUNKER ELEM., around 0.0 miles off. Among the 7 schools in that immediate cluster with test data (this one included), BUNKER HIGH ranks 2nd on composite proficiency, above the local average of 53.6%.
The campus sits in a low-density setting.
Over the past 7-year window. Looking back 7 years, enrollment at BUNKER HIGH has stayed largely flat, going from 122 students in 2018 to 123 in 2025. The student-to-teacher ratio pulled in from 13.7:1 in 2018 to 10.2:1 today.
